What is a fertilizer correlation?
• Compare yields of non-fertilized areas to fertilized areas • across a range of soil nutrient levels – low to high • measured by a nutrient extractor – Bray, Mehlich... • Relative yields are used to compare across environments
• “Critical level”
• Where a non-fertilized yield almost equals a fertilized yield
Relative Yield % = Yield of plot with no fertilizer
Maximum yield from fertilized plot x 100

North Central Soybean Critical Levels
Source Term used Mehlich-3 or Bray-P1 Soil depth
ppm Inches
Kansas State Univ. Critical Level 20 6
North Dakota State Univ. Critical Level 15 6
South Dakota State Univ. Critical Level 15 6
Nebraska Univ. Critical Level 12 8
Iowa State Univ. Optimum 16-20 6
Michigan State Univ. Maintenance Fertilizer 15-30 8

Broadcast Results
------------------- P2O5 lbs / acre ---------------
Location Mehlich 3 P 0 20 40 60 80 100 Probability
County ppm -------------------- Yield bu / acre ---------------
Woodson - 2011 5 32 B† 38 A 37 A 37 A 37 A -- 0.07
Lyon 8 17 17 18 17 19 18 0.57
Douglas 11 43 43 41 43 46 45 0.90
Atchison 11 48 B 41 C 50 B 48 B* 53 AB 58 A 0.00
Woodson - upland 16 32 36 37 34 33 34 0.42
Woodson - lowland 16 60 61 61 61 60 61 0.76
Cherokee - 2011 16 28 26 28 29 29 -- 0.66
Riley - Manhattan 21 53 51 54 53 51 56 0.65
Riley - Randolph 23 56 59 57 59 58 62 0.32
* Plot 203 removed

Summary Correlation Data
Broadcast vs with starter
No response was seen above 16 ppm in 2013 The critical level could be between 15 and 20 ppm P
No difference was observed when similar amounts of P were applied
Remember phosphorus removal
0.8 lb P2O5 / bushel
